Just swapped my motor. Now not accelerating as fast?
so i just put in another single in my 4dr after throwing rod. its and automatic and just my daily driver... I had the d16y7. and bought an imported d15b. im pretty sure i installed everything right i even took step by step pics of the pull out to remember where things went.... Now the problem is it takes forever to take off from a dead stop. i can literally floor it and it still wont speed up til around 3,000 or 4,000 rpm. i also noticed it bogs at around 1700. any ideas of what it could be????Thanks for any input.
(this was my first time swapping a motor.)
